3 Press the shutter-release Focus point button halfway. Press the shutter-release button halfway to focus (if the subject is poorly lit, the flash may pop up and the AF-assist illuminator may light). When the focus operation is complete, the Focus indicator active focus point and in- focus indicator (I) will appear in the viewfinder. In-focus indicator I F H FH (flashes) Description Subject in focus. Focus point is between camera and subject. Focus point is behind subject. Camera unable to focus using autofocus. See page 131. 4 Shoot. Smoothly press the shutter-release button the rest of the way down to take the photograph. The memory card access lamp will light and the photograph will be displayed in the monitor Memory card access lamp for a few seconds. Do not eject the memory card or remove or disconnect the power source until the lamp has gone out and recording is complete. 36
